Corporate Video Production Breakdown

Let’s go through these bite-sized steps to show you how we work and how to get the most out of your corporate video.
Initial Briefing: Once you’ve decided to work with us, we’ll set up a time to speak in which we’ll ask you about your company, your audience, and your intentions for this corporate video. The goal is to get an understanding of what your company’s goals are. But we also want to gather information from a marketing standpoint. Do you have brand guidelines, colors, logos that should be used? Do you have any tonal references that we can use to guide our video production plan. After this 15-30 minute call, our team will get to work on creating a game plan.
First Consultation: At this stage, we’ll present you with our idea for our corporate video. We’ll explain exactly what we plan to use for graphics, footage, music, background, etc. This will be a creative discussion as we’ll ask for feedback and adjust our course of action based on that.
Script Writing: Now that we have our basic structure, our team will get to work on the script. This is the real bones of the corporate video, and therefore, a lot of time and effort is put into this portion of the process. We want to make sure we’re getting the words pitch perfect, and that we’re covering all the bases you require. Once the first draft of the script is finished, we’ll send it to you to gather any feedback and revise accordingly. After the script is approved, we’re off to the races.
Production / Editing: The script is filmed and/or animated, and then passed to our editor, who puts the final touches on everything. This is when everything that we’ve discussed really comes together and ideas come to life.
Final Consultation & Corporate Video Delivery: Now that the first draft of the corporate video is finished, we’ll deliver to your team and, once again, receive any feedback or editing notes. This is the most collaborative part of the process because this video is no longer abstract. We have an actual product to work with, and we can make any minor adjustments to make sure it’s in the best place possible. We’ll make the changes and deliver the finished video in 4K.
